Into the Streets is one of the largest student community improvement efforts of the year. Projects for 2009 include everything from painting low-income housing for women, beautification projects, computer renovations, and other capacity building projects for area non-profits. 2008 Statistics On Saturday, October 4th, 150 of you worked on 18 different service teams--and what a variety of teams! You scrubbed windows, swept glass, and picked up litter along the various business districts in our Uptown community. You planted, mulched, weeded, and cleared major debris in at least five of our city parks. You painted an outdoor picnic area at Hughes High school, alongside Hughes students. You cleared out junk and furniture from classrooms and the basement at the Clifton Cultural Arts Center. You worked with Over-the-Rhine Community Housing agency at a nearby school. You registered voters for the November election and shared information on community involvement. You identified graffiti and other blighted areas. And you swept through our neighborhood with your bags, your gloves, your trash-pickers, and your work ethic, wiping the streets clean of litter.
